The module has a socket for a rechargeable lithium cell LR2032 and a simple charging circuit.
Since the current drawn from the battery is very tiny, and a standard CR2032 cell will last way over 5 years, it does not make much sense to invest in one of the very expensive, rechargeable cells. If you want to use a standard CR2032 lithium cell, you only need to interrupt the charging circuit by removing one component. Please see the picture gallery for details.
- 2-wire connection SDA/SCL
- Operating voltage 3.3V – 5.5V DC
- Multiple libraries (from different authors) are available
